As part of our ongoing commitment to keep kids safe, St. Mary’s Children’s Services and Kohl’s are once again teaming up to sponsor “Celebrate Safety with the Evansville Otters” on Friday, August 12 at Bosse Field.  The Otters will host the Southern Illinois Miners at 6:35 p.m.

Ticket vouchers are now available.  You can pick-up ticket vouchers to the Otters game, courtesy of St. Mary’s and Kohl’s, at St. Mary’s Center for Children or at Kohl’s locations in Evansville.  The vouchers should be redeemed at Bosse Field for a FREE game ticket.  Tickets are subject to availability.  The first 500 kids through the gates, age 12 and under, will receive a free bike helmet.  The Evansville Bicycle Club will fit the helmets for the kids.

There will be excitement throughout the evening, as St. Mary’s LifeFlight helicopter will land in the outfield at Bosse Field to deliver the baseball for the ceremonial first pitch.  And make sure you stay for a special fireworks display after the game.

As the lead agency for SAFE KIDS Vanderburgh and Warrick County, and the areas only Trauma Center verified in Pediatrics, St. Mary’s is committed to the safety of children in the Tri-State area.

For the past eleven years, Kohl’s has partnered with St. Mary’s to develop a program to Keep Kids Safe.  “Celebrate Safety with the Evansville Otters” is a safety event and the kickoff for this year’s program.

Kohl’s will present St. Mary’s with a check for $63,841 during the seventh-inning stretch of the Otters game.

Since 2006, Kohl’s has donated more than $768,000 to St. Mary’s Children’s Services. Kohl’s commitment to St. Mary’s Children’s Services is made possible through the Kohl’s Cares® cause merchandise program. Through this initiative, Kohl’s sells $5 books and plush toys, where 100 percent of net profit benefits children’s health initiatives nationwide, including hospital partnerships like this one. Kohl’s has raised more $300 million through this merchandise program.
